Figaro pours a dark golden apricot and diffuses light pretty beautifully with a consistent haziness. The thin head dissipates quickly. Aroma is a funky mild vinegar citrus and oak. The mouth feel is a sturdy medium with good carbonation. First sip is decently sour with oak and a nice honey sweetness to balance. We picked up a lot of citrus with some cracker and sweet fruits like apricot and maybe some white grapes. It ends slightly dry and balanced with the sour fading out.
